The decomposition of hydrogen iodide on finely divided gold at 150°C is zero order with respect to HI. The rate defined below is constant at 1.20 × 10¬4 mol/L·s. Au 2 HI(9) Н2 (9) + 12(9) A[HI] = k = 1.20 × 10¬ª mol/L · s At Rate = - a. If the initial HI concentration was 0.500 mol/L, calculate the concentration of HI at 23 minutes after the start of the reaction. Concentration = M b. How long will it take for all of the 0.500 M HI to decompose? Time = min
